Actual Performances of PV Panels in the Local

The whole year ''s data was collected from the solar PV power generation system. The annual energy output of the PV system from Oct 10th 2018 to Oct 9 th 2019 is 1916.1 kWh. The maximum daily energy output is 10.6 kWh on Nov 30 2018. and installation costs were assumed when they are installed on a building roof without any shading .

What is PV power generation? How to calculate power generation?

The power generation efficiency of PV modules depends on the design and quality of PV panels. PV power generation is the total amount of electricity generated by a PV power plant, usually measured in kilowatt-hours (kWh). The basic formula for calculating PV power generation is: PV power generation = installed capacity of PV panels × total

How to choose a solar energy system?

The designer should choose between the efficiency and the cost of the system. To estimate the output power the solar energy assessment of the selected site is of foremost significance. Insolation is defined as the measure of the sun’s energy received in a specified area over a period of time.

How to choose a solar installation site?

Thus, the following points must be considered for the assessment and selection of locations for installation. Minimum Shade: It must be made sure that the selected site either at rooftop or ground should not have shades or should not have any structure that intercepts the solar radiation falling on the panels to be installed.

Where can solar panels be installed?

Solar panels, or arrays, can be installed in various locations. They are most commonly mounted on roofs or on steel poles set in concrete. However, they can also be mounted at ground level, on building walls, or as part of a shade structure like a patio cover.
